“A lot of times, I hear indigenous artists talk about their work almost like it’s a prayer,” said Tehee.

Despite the complications of defining Cherokee “art,” Meredith said the Cherokees are fortunate.

“It’s kind of a blessing that art historians do not write about Cherokee art very much,” she said. “We’re the only ones who write about our own art, so we kind of have that freedom, and we get to direct that conversation.”
